I have just shifted to Pasir Ris 6 months ago, prior to moving here, I did bring my son last year to do a site inspection at Star Learners @ Pasir Ris.
My son is actually from Star Learners @ Simei since Playgroup till now in K2.
Initially we wanted to transfer him to Star Learners @ Pasir Ris but like my husband and I, he didn't like it either.
Here are our comments:
It's also a landed property converted to a child care centre, interior is like a maze but less organized compared to the one at Simei which is clean, neat and bright.
I observed the transparent plastic covers which is protecting the wall charts etc, some of the sides are coming off in some classes, both upstairs and downstairs.
Call me idiosyncrasy........but to me, day in and day out from Mon-Fri, nobody saw this? No one seems to bother sticking it back properly?
When i look for a child care, my utmost concern is the degree of cleanliness and hygiene the school and teachers practiced.
I met some of the teachers but they didn't appear friendly or approachable, too busy with their own kids I guess.
We all agreed the feel is different, probably we had a comparison.
Sorry we didn't had a positive feeling for Star Learners @ Pasir Ris, but then again, it varies individually.
